随着科技的飞速发展,人工智能(AI)已经成为了改变我们工作和生活方式的重要力量。无论是在商业、医疗还是教育领域,AI的应用都极大地提高了效率和准确性。然而,对于许多个人用户来说,高昂的AI软件费用可能让他们望而却步。幸运的是,市场上存在许多免费且功能强大的AI软件,它们可以帮助你轻松实现自动化和智能化办公。本文将为你介绍几款最受欢迎的免费AI工具,让你在不花一分钱的情况下也能享受到AI带来的便利。
- Google Colab
- 简介:Google Colab是一个基于云的交互式环境,允许用户在浏览器中运行Python代码。它提供了丰富的机器学习库,如TensorFlow和Scikit-learn,以及Jupyter Notebook界面,方便进行数据分析和可视化。
- 特点:无需安装任何软件,只需通过浏览器即可使用;提供实时结果预览功能,方便调试;支持多种数据格式输入,如CSV、JSON等。
- 适用场景:适合需要进行数据分析、机器学习实验的用户;特别适合初学者快速上手。
- Microsoft Azure AI
- 简介:Azure AI是微软提供的一套AI服务,包括语音识别、图像识别、自然语言处理等功能。它支持多种编程语言,如Python、C#等,并提供了丰富的API接口供开发者使用。
- 特点:集成度高,与Azure其他服务无缝对接;支持多租户模式,可灵活扩展资源;提供详细的文档和示例代码,便于开发者学习和使用。
- 适用场景:适合需要大规模数据处理和分析的企业用户;特别适合需要与Azure其他服务协同工作的场景。
- OpenCV
- 简介:OpenCV是一个开源的计算机视觉库,提供了丰富的图像处理和计算机视觉算法。它支持多种编程语言,如Python、C++等,并提供了丰富的API接口供开发者使用。
- 特点:功能强大,涵盖了图像处理、特征检测、目标跟踪等多个方面;社区活跃,有大量的教程和案例可供参考;支持跨平台开发,方便在不同环境下使用。
- 适用场景:适合需要进行图像处理和计算机视觉研究的科研人员;特别适合需要快速实现原型开发的开发者。
- TensorFlow
- 简介:TensorFlow是由Google推出的一款开源机器学习框架,支持多种编程语言,如Python、C++等。它提供了丰富的API接口和工具箱,使得构建复杂的神经网络模型变得简单易行。
- 特点:灵活性高,可以自定义网络结构;支持GPU加速计算,提高训练速度;社区庞大,有大量的教程和案例可供参考;支持多种数据集和评估指标。
- 适用场景:适合需要进行深度学习研究的科研人员;特别适合需要快速实现原型开发的开发者。
- Scikit-Learn
- 简介:Scikit-Learn是一个基于Python的机器学习库,提供了丰富的分类、回归、聚类等算法。它支持多种数据格式输入,如CSV、HDF5等,并提供了详细的文档和示例代码供开发者使用。
- 特点:易于上手,无需深入理解算法原理;支持多种编程语言,如Python、R等;提供了大量的预训练模型,方便直接使用;支持多种评估指标和参数调优方法。
- 适用场景:适合需要进行数据预处理和特征工程的研究人员;特别适合需要快速实现原型开发的开发者。
- Keras
- 简介:Keras是由Google推出的一个高级API,用于构建和训练深度学习模型。它提供了丰富的卷积神经网络(CNN)组件,使得构建复杂的图像处理任务变得简单易行。
- 特点:高度模块化,可以轻松复用不同模块;支持GPU加速计算,提高训练速度;提供了大量的预训练模型,方便直接使用;支持多种评估指标和优化方法。
- 适用场景:适合需要进行图像处理和计算机视觉研究的科研人员;特别适合需要快速实现原型开发的开发者。
以上六款免费AI软件各有特色,覆盖了从数据处理到模型训练再到结果展示的全流程。无论你是需要进行数据分析、机器学习实验,还是需要构建复杂的神经网络模型,这些工具都能为你提供强大的支持。赶快尝试一下这些免费且功能强大的AI软件吧!
